According to Chinese lore, the Wuyi Mountains are where the Immortals gather to drink tea together. The regions tradition of tea making dates back over 2,000 years. This rich cultural heritage earned the mountain range a place as a UNESCO Heritage Site for both cultural and natural worlds. Wuyi Mountains produces world renown oolong tea, also know as Yan Cha, Rock Tea, and is the birthplace of black tea. It is also known as the region of the most expensive tea in the world.
